Montlivaultia retorta

Astraeidae

Taxonomy
Caryophyllia retorta was named by Michelin (1846). It is a 3D body fossil.

It was recombined as Lasmophyllia retorta by d'Orbigny (1850); it was recombined as Montlivaultia retorta by Milne-Edwards (1857).
